About C. K. Ong

C. K. Ong is a scholar working on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ials, Materials Chemistry,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, Electrical and Electronic Engineering and Condensed Matter Physics, having authored 401 papers that have together received 8.8k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Magnetic properties of thin films (111 papers), Magnetic and transport properties of perovskites and related materials (67 papers), Magnetic Properties and Applications (59 papers), Multiferroics and related materials (47 papers), Advanced Condensed Matter Physics (47 papers), Metallic Glasses and Amorphous Alloys (47 papers), Ferroelectric and Piezoelectric Materials (46 papers) and Electronic and Structural Properties of Oxides (40 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ials (5.3k citations), Condensed Matter Physics (1.2k citations), Materials Chemistry (4.4k citations),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ics (2.4k citations) and Electrical and Electronic Engineering (2.6k citations). C. K. Ong has collaborated with scholars based in Singapore, China and France. Frequent co-authors include Nguyen N. Phuoc, Linfeng Chen, C.Y. Tan, X. S. Rao, Feng Xu, Liu Hon, Jun‐Ming Liu, Zhiwei Li, W. C. Goh and Jie Li.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Applied Physics, Applied Physics Letters, Journal of Physics Condensed Matter, Physica C Superconductivity and Journal of Magnetism and Magnetic Materials.
